mĕthŏdĭcus
mĕthŏdĭcus, a, um, adj., = μεθοδικός, methodical, belonging to a particular school (post-Aug.): medicina, Tert. Anim. 6: disciplina, Cael. Aur. Tard. 4, 1, 6: medici, Cels. praef. § 13.
